Construction Heavy Equipment Operator

Weekly Travel Required

Reporting to the Project Manager, the Construction Heavy Equipment Operator operates various types of heavy machinery and equipment used in construction projects related to civil engineering. These operators are skilled professionals who ensure the safe and efficient operation of machinery such as bulldozers, excavators, loaders, graders, and compactors.

RESPONSIBILITIES

  • Operate heavy machinery and equipment according to project requirements and safety guidelines.
  • Conduct pre-operation inspections to ensure machinery is in proper working condition.
  • Maneuver equipment to perform tasks such as digging, grading, leveling, and compacting surfaces.
  • Interpret blueprints, plans, and specifications to determine project requirements.
  • Collaborate with construction crew members and supervisors to coordinate work activities.
  • Ensure compliance with all safety regulations and procedures to prevent accidents and injuries on the job site.
  • Monitor equipment operation to identify and address any performance issues or malfunctions.
  • Adhere to project schedules and deadlines, completing tasks in a timely and efficient manner.
  • Communicate effectively with team members and supervisors to report progress, issues, and concerns.

SKILLS REQUIRED

  • 10 years of field construction experience.
  • 5 years as a heavy equipment operator.
  • GPS experience. Trimble preferred.
  • Dozer | Excavator fine grading experience.
  • Pipe experience.
  • Site work experience.
  • Certification or training in heavy equipment operation preferred.
  • Proven experience operating heavy machinery in a construction.
  • Knowledge of safety protocols and procedures related to heavy equipment operation.
  • Ability to interpret blueprints, plans, and specifications.
  • Strong mechanical aptitude and troubleshooting skills.
  • Physical stamina and endurance to withstand long hours and perform demanding tasks in various weather conditions.
  • Effective communication skills and the ability to work well in a team environment.
  • Valid driver's license and a clean driving record. Class 1 preferred.
